Towards the left is a house with a high-pitched roof, in which are four dormer windows with little gables. More to the right is a shed with a wooden gable-end and doors opened wide; beyond it a tall tree rises behind a wall. To the left of the open shed Is a horse harnessed to a cart; a man Is in the cart, and two men stand near the wheel; behind them a spade leans against the open door. On the extreme left is the end of a cart with its shafts turned up; the wheel is cut by the end of the plate. Three fowls are seen in front of the open door.
Dodgson, Campbell. "Continuation of Etchings & Dry Points by Muirhead Bone. I. 1898-1907 : A Catalogue by Campbell Dodgson." Obach & Co., 1909, London.
